Comparing RFID Ceramic Tags with Plastic and Metal Tag Options

When you're diving into choosing RFID tags for today's industries, it's really important to understand what makes RFID ceramic tags stand out compared to plastic or metal ones. These ceramic tags are known for being incredibly tough and able to withstand rough environmental conditions—perfect for stuff like manufacturing plants or outdoor logistics. Unlike plastic tags, which can crack or become brittle over time, or metal tags that might mess with radio signals, ceramic tags keep their performance intact and reliably do their job, especially when tracking assets or IDs.

Plus, ceramic tags generally give you a better read range and stronger signals. Being non-metallic, they work way better in places with liquids or conductive materials—areas where metal tags might fail or give wonky readings. That’s why industries like food, beverage, pharma, and electronics often lean on ceramic tags—they need to keep quality high and stay compliant with safety rules. Picking RFID ceramic tags can really boost how smoothly operations run and help manage assets more efficiently—without the headaches caused by faulty tags or interruptions.
